According to a survey by the International Workplace Group (IWG) of over 1,000 remote workers around the world, the city of Budapest - the capital of Hungary was honored in the first position in this year's rankings, according to CNBC.
The city is famous for its classical architecture, attracting about 12 million international visitors each year, with more than 200 museums and galleries, vibrant neighborhoods and vast green spaces. It's no surprise that Budapest has become an ideal place for people who come both to work and to relax.

IWG's report compared 30 cities globally, ranked on a 10-point scale in categories such as: Transportation, accommodation, cost of living, climate, culture, cuisine...
Founder and CEO of IWG - Mr. Mark Dixon, said that the criteria chosen above are to help measure the comfort or convenience of the foreign environment, especially in terms of responsibility. job.
Other cities also in the top 10 most ideal places to both work and relax this year according to IWG's report include: Barcelona (Spain), Rio de Janeiro (Brazil), Beijing (China) . ), Lisbon (Portugal), New York (USA), Singapore, Jakarta (Indonesia), Los Angeles (USA), Milan (Italy).
